Bertie has indicated today that he envisages 2 referenda next summer: the necessary ratification of the EU amending treaty, and the children’s rights referendum. As he says the logic is to roll them together, but it does make one wonder what exactly the rush was for the latter back in Spring of this year if it can now wait another year. As for the EU vote, the ICTU has laid down some preliminary markers of their attitude to it. There’s also the risk that the deteriorating economic and fiscal positions could feed into the public’s attitude to the EU vote.
